Bruce Willis has returned to the site of one of his most famous movies, "Die Hard."
The actor's wife, Emma Heming Willis, recently posted a video on her verified Instagram account showing her husband visiting Fox Plaza in Los Angeles, which served as the set for the Nakatomi Plaza from his iconic 1988 film, "Die Hard." .
"Nakatomi Plaza 34 years later #happymovieanniversary #diehard @20thcenturystudios," he wrote in the comments.
Bruce Willis visited Nakatomi Plaza 34 years after the premiere of the movie "Die Hard".
Willis' family announced in March that the star would be taking a break from acting due to his diagnosis of aphasia, which affects his cognitive abilities.
What is aphasia, the disease that Bruce Willis suffers from?
According to the Mayo Clinic, aphasia is "a condition that affects the ability to communicate" and can be caused by a stroke, head injury, brain tumor or some other condition.
Willis' wife has shared updates on the actor's life since his diagnosis was made known, including a video of Willis at a basketball game with friends.
